I loved watching Malcolm in the Middle through high school in the 2000s, and always identified aspects of their rowdy chaotic family with my less-rowdy-but-imperfect family life. Now that I'm watching it in my late 20s, it's even better that I remember it.
Part of it is living on the other side of the world to my brothers and missing our teenage conflicts and brotherly solidarity, but now I have a whole lot more appreciation for Lois and Hal doing their best. They're flawed and loving and well-developed characters, and the script and editing are full of real laugh out loud jokes throughout all the episodes. Any of the main and recurring characters are valid favourite characters.
It's made it clear how for all of the things I enjoy in modern comedies, I first saw in this show.
